首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用CSI和Kubernetes动态扩展存储

本文介绍如何扩展最新的Container Storage Interface 0.2.0并与Kubernetes集成,演示动态扩展存储容量的基本。...考虑到可扩展性和技术成熟程度,Kubernetes和Docker位居榜首。但是,将单体应用程序迁移到像Kubernetes这样的分布式编排很有挑战性,而关系型数据库对于迁移至关重要。...目前,扩展存储仅适用于那些存储供应商: - gcePersistentDisk - awsElasticBlockStore - OpenStack Cinder - glusterfs - rbd...遗憾的是,即使底层存储提供商具有此功能,也无法通过容器存储接口(CSI)和Kubernetes动态扩展存储。...本文将简要介绍CSI,然后详细介绍如何在现有CSI和Kubernetes上引入新的扩展存储功能。最后,本文将演示如何动态扩展存储容量。 链接以了解更多。

1K20
您找到你想要的搜索结果了吗?
是的
没有找到

数据库分割扩展

这意味着数据层沿着X轴扩展,N个数据库中的每一个将有与其他N-1个系统完全相同的数据 X轴分割方法比较简单,也就是我们常使用的主从模式,常用的一主多从,少用的多主多 而且数据库内置自备复制能力,实施也比较简单...负责管理平台基础设施团队不需要担心大量独特配置的数据模式或存储系统 但X轴扩展也不是毫无节制,X轴扩展从数据一致角度看,是数据库“最终一致性”,意味着经过短暂间隔后,复制技术可以确保数据库的状态完全被复制到所有其他的数据库...而且X轴扩展技术无法解决固有的数据规模增加所带来的扩展限制问题 比如当数据量增加时,数据库响应时间增加;虽然索引有助于显著减少响应时间增加,但表规模如果增加10倍,仍然会导致响应时间增加 X轴复制也有数据复制所带来的成本...比如现在流行的微服务架构,各个系统对应个独立的数据库,这就是相应的Y轴扩展 Z轴 Z轴代表基于在交易时查找的或者确定的属性分割工作。...解决方案是沿Z轴方向,通过分割用户和创建多个不同的用户数据库扩展 应该在什么时候采用X轴分割,什么时候考虑Y轴和Z轴分割?

1.1K30

Mesos:数据库使用的持久化

持久化是由新的acceptOffers API引入的特性。持久化让用户可以为Mesos构建数据库框架,Mesos可以在任何不可预见的故障和错误发生并且影响整个系统时,使数据持久化。...如果MySQL数据库能够自动将自身备份,并且按需创建新的副本,是不是很好呢?或者如果拥有一个简单的,自服务的REST API,能够创建新的Riak和Cassandra集群,又会怎么样呢?...为Mesos构建数据库框架的工作从2014年就开始了。这些框架的问题是每个主机都必须创建特别的数据分区,并且在Mesos之外加以管理。...完成这一功能的API和挂载主机的Marathon API(详见“挂载主机”部分),几乎完全一致。用户甚至可以创建不持久的,这在想将多个独立磁盘暴露给Mesos时会很有用。...仅仅能够在已经被预留的磁盘资源上创建持久化。通常,用户会预留资源,创建,并且在单个acceptOffers里启动任务,如下面示例所示。

76120

数据库层如何扩展

写在前面 理论上,有了可靠的负载均衡机制,我们就能将 1 台服务器轻松扩展到 n 台,然而,如果这 n 台机器仍然使用同一数据库的话,很快数据库就会成为系统的性能瓶颈和可靠性瓶颈 那么,如何提升数据库的处理能力...从资源的角度来看,无非两种思路: 纵向扩展:提升单机配置(硬盘、内存、CPU 等等),但同样会遭遇单机性能瓶颈 横向扩展:增加机器,数量上从单数据库实例扩展到多实例 这样看来,似乎只要加几个数据库,共同分担来自应用层的流量就完成了从单库到多库的扩展...一.一致性问题 如果同一数据存在多份拷贝,那么就需要考虑如何保证其一致性 (摘自一致性模式) 数据库与应用服务最大的区别在于,应用服务可以是无状态的(或者可以将共享状态抽离出去,比如放到数据库),而数据库操作一定是有状态的...,在扩展数据库时必须要考虑数据的一致性 具体的,一致性分为 3 种,严格程度依次递减: 强一致性(Strong consistency):写完之后,立即就能读到 最终一致性(Eventual consistency...):写完之后,保证最终能读到 弱一致性(Weak consistency):写完之后,不一定能读到 二.Replication 所以,从单库扩展成多库,至少要有一种数据更新同步机制,称之为Replication

1.1K30

E-commerce 中促销系统的设计

在电商平台中,促销是必不可少的营销手段,尤其在国内 各种玩法层出不穷,最开始的满减/秒杀 到优惠 再到 拼团/砍价等等 一个良好的促销系统应该具备易于扩展,易于统计促销效果等特点,在遇到秒杀类促销时还需要做到可扩容...这样设计最大好处是 rule与action相互独立且高度抽象, 运营人员与开发人员可以自由组合rule和action来达到最大灵活性与可扩展数据库设计 Promotion Schema::create...未来如果有机会的话会设计一些促销系统扩展等提供参考....上面便是一个促销系统的流程思路,下面多提供一些demo供参考 优惠 已一张10元代金为例,我们会有这样两条记录 // promotion { id: 1, code: '10-cash...对于config中的配置适用于各种优惠,如满减,运费等等.

3.3K50

Mysql实例 数据库优化--数据库架构扩展

五.数据库架构扩展 随着业务量越来越大,单台数据库服务器性能已无法满足业务需求,该考虑增加服务器扩展架构了。...增加缓存 给数据库增加缓存系统,把热数据缓存到内存中,如果缓存中有请求的数据就不再去请求MySQL,减少数据库负载。缓存实现有本地缓存和分布式缓存,本地缓存是将数据缓存到本地服务器内存中或者文件中。...分布式缓存可以缓存海量数据,扩展性好,主流的分布式缓存系统:memcached、redis,memcached性能稳定,数据缓存在内存中,速度很快,QPS理论可达8w左右。...主从复制与读写分离 在生产环境中,业务系统通常读多写少,可部署一主多从架构,主数据库负责写操作,并做双机热备,多台从数据库做负载均衡,负责读操作。...在这种MySQL主从复制拓扑架构中,分散单台负载,大大提高数据库并发能力。如果一台从服务器能处理1500 QPS,那么3台就能处理4500 QPS,而且容易横向扩展

2K20

AI-Native数据库正在打造新一代金融基础设施

互联网带来的行为数据要远远大于交易数据,而且需要高并发、高扩展、更松耦合的高服务架构能力来完成。...能支持流批一体的数据库,更善于处理大量的、复杂的、互联的、多变的网状数据,其效率远高于传统的关系型数据库的百倍、千倍甚至万倍。...图2 智能权益服务平台“流批一体”实时应用 AI-Native数据库正在打造新一代金融基础设施 如图3所示,“BigIdeas 2021”提出“Deep Learning”概念,即软件2.0时代。...相信随着人工智能认知计算的普及落地,更多机器数据生产消费,AI-Native数据库将会主导和统一市场,成为新一代金融基础设施。 结语 数据库是基础软件皇冠上的明珠,是每一家公司业务系统的核心。...谁能提供支持混合负载的混布数据库技术,提供流批一体技术服务,谁就能对抗西方在开源系统封装服务领域的现有市场,就能定义新一代金融基础设施。

43820

关注这些腾讯公号,助你走上人生巅峰(送价值万元的福利)

04 腾讯云代金券 腾讯云数据库100元无门槛代金券,新购云数据库产品可直接抵现(促销产品除外)。 ---- 各位朋友,心动不如行动,领取方式见下: 领奖规则 1. ...腾讯云数据库 扫码回复“抽奖”,100%中奖: 1.云数据库100元代金券,新购云数据库可直接抵现 2.本次活动书单中的任意一本书籍 3.数据库实战视频教程 (三种奖品任一) 腾讯云数据库官方大号 资深大牛带你学习数据库...TDSQL数据库 扫码回复“抽奖”,有机会获得: 1.云数据库100元代金券,新购云数据库可直接抵现 2.本次活动书单中的任意一本书籍 分享分布式数据库的前沿技术、 实战经验和解决方案 ?...书单说明请向上滑动阅览 《漫画算法:小灰的算法之旅》魏梦舒(@程序员小灰)著 全网阅读量近1000万次的算法故事;轻松入门算法与数据结构,开发岗面试不再慌 《狼书(1):更了不起的Node.js》狼叔著...狼叔千日三始成,狼书之外再无Node!

3.8K62

关注这些腾讯公号,助你走上人生巅峰(送价值万元的福利)

04 腾讯云代金券 腾讯云数据库100元无门槛代金券,新购云数据库产品可直接抵现(促销产品除外)。 ---- 各位朋友,心动不如行动,领取方式见下: 领奖规则 1. ...腾讯云数据库 扫码回复“抽奖”,100%中奖: 1.云数据库100元代金券,新购云数据库可直接抵现 2.本次活动书单中的任意一本书籍 3.数据库实战视频教程 (三种奖品任一) 腾讯云数据库官方大号 资深大牛带你学习数据库...TDSQL数据库 扫码回复“抽奖”,有机会获得: 1.云数据库100元代金券,新购云数据库可直接抵现 2.本次活动书单中的任意一本书籍 分享分布式数据库的前沿技术、 实战经验和解决方案 ?...书单说明请向上滑动阅览 《漫画算法:小灰的算法之旅》魏梦舒(@程序员小灰)著 全网阅读量近1000万次的算法故事;轻松入门算法与数据结构,开发岗面试不再慌 《狼书(1):更了不起的Node.js》狼叔著...狼叔千日三始成,狼书之外再无Node!

3.5K50

关注这些腾讯公众号,学技术还能领价值万元的福利

04 腾讯云代金券 腾讯云数据库100元无门槛代金券,新购云数据库产品可直接抵现(促销产品除外)。 ---- 各位朋友,心动不如行动,领取方式见下: 领奖规则 1. ...腾讯云数据库 扫码回复“抽奖”,100%中奖: 1.云数据库100元代金券,新购云数据库可直接抵现 2.本次活动书单中的任意一本书籍 3.数据库实战视频教程 腾讯云数据库官方大号 资深大牛带你学习数据库...TDSQL数据库 扫码回复“抽奖”,100%中奖: 1.云数据库100元代金券,新购云数据库可直接抵现 2.本次活动书单中的任意一本书籍 分享分布式数据库的前沿技术、 实战经验和解决方案 ?...书单说明请向上滑动阅览 《漫画算法:小灰的算法之旅》魏梦舒(@程序员小灰)著 全网阅读量近1000万次的算法故事;轻松入门算法与数据结构,开发岗面试不再慌 《狼书(1):更了不起的Node.js》狼叔著...狼叔千日三始成,狼书之外再无Node!

4.1K40
领券